Dealey Campbell]</schema:creator><schema:creator>Harmon Schepps</schema:creator><schema:artMedium>Born digital (.m2ts file)</schema:artMedium><schema:description>Videotaped oral history interview with Harmon Schepps. The founder of Schepps Diary in Dallas, Schepps attended the Trade Mart luncheon on November 22, 1963, and later visited Jack Ruby in jail. An acquaintance of Ruby since the mid-1950s, Schepps manufactured the sign for the Carousel Club.</schema:description><schema:artForm>Oral Histories</schema:artForm><schema:url>https://emuseum.jfk.org/objects/29816/rdf</schema:url></schema:VisualArtwork></rdf:RDF>
